'Shucked' To Launch North American Tour In Fall 2024

Shucked, the Tony Award®-winning musical comedy will embark on a North American tour in the fall of 2024. The tour will tech and begin performances at the Providence Performing Arts Center in Rhode Island and will play over 30 cities in its first season including AtlantaAustinBuffaloCharlotteChicagoDallasDurhamEast LansingFort LauderdaleGreenvilleHoustonLos AngelesMadisonNashvilleOrlandoSan AntonioSchenectady, St. LouisWashington D.C., and of course… Tampa with many more to be announced.

Shucked features a book by Tony Award winner Robert Horn, a score filled with songs by Grammy Award winners, Tony Award nominees and Nashville music superstars Brandy Clark and Shane McAnally, and direction by three-time Tony Award winner Jack O’Brien. Casting for the tour will be announced at a later date.

With choreography by Sarah O’Gleby, and music supervision, music direction, orchestrations, and arrangements by 2023 Tony Award, Drama Desk, and Outer Critics Circle Award nominee Jason Howland, the design team for Shucked includes 2023 Tony Award nominee and Tony Award winner Scott Pask (scenic design), 2023 Drama Desk Award nominee Tilly Grimes (costume design), Tony Award nominee Japhy Weideman (lighting design), Tony Award winner and 2023 Drama Desk Award nominee John Shivers (sound design), Academy Award® winner and Emmy Award® winner Mia Neal (wig design), and Stephen Kopel, C12 Casting (casting director).
